Tampilkan postingan dengan label Pemrograman. Tampilkan semua postingan
Tampilkan postingan dengan label Pemrograman. Tampilkan semua postingan

Jumat, 19 Agustus 2016

Perkembangan HTML (Hypertext Markup Language)

Pengertian HTML

HTML atau HyperText Markup Language adalah sebuah bahasa pemrograman yang digunakan untuk membuat sebuah website sehingga dari halaman website tersebut dapat menampilkan informasi yang berguna bagi para pengguna internet.

Baca Juga: Pengertian dan Fungsi HTML (Hypertext Markup Language)

HTML Versi 4.0 dan Seterusnya

HTML 4.0 sebuah bahasa pemrograman web yang diperkenalkan oleh World Wide Web Consortium (W3C) pada bulan Desember tahun 1997, yang antara lain menyertakan fitur CSS (Cascading Style Sheets), yang mendukung pembuatan aplikasi yang dinamis. HTML menjadi sangat fenomenal karena banyak orang yang mulai menggunakan HTML.


Tahun 1999 muncul HTML 4.1. Setelah kemunculan HTML 4.1, XHTML 1 lahir. Secara prinsip spesifikasi pada XHTML sama seperti pada HTML 4.01. Hal yang membedakan adalah sintaks bahasanya. XHTML menerapkan aturan yang lebih ketat daripada HTML, yakni mengharuskan pembuat dokumen harus mengikuti aturan XML (eXtended Markup Language). Selain itu, dalam penulisan dokumen semua tag dan atribut dalam dokumen harus ditulis dengan menggunakan huruf kecil, sementara pada HTML, tag dan atribut boleh ditulis dengan huruf capital, huruf kecil, ataupun kombinasi. XHTML 1.0 diteruskan dengan XHTML 2.0. Namun, versi yang terbaru ini kurang mendapat tanggapan dari para vendor.

Baca Juga: Pengertian Website dan Sejarah Website

HTML Versi 5 (HTML5)

HTML5 (angka 5 dan HTML tidak dipisahkan oleh spasi) dikembangkan oleh badan lain yaitu WHATMG (Web Hypertext Application Technology Working Group). Spesifikasi HTML5 belum final saat ini, tetapi diyakini oleh banyak orang akan menjadi standar yang diterima di masa depan. Walaupun belum final, HTML5 telah menebar pesona. Beberapa browser (lihat Tabel 1.1) sudah mendukung HTML5.

Senin, 15 Agustus 2016

Pengertian Web Master dan Tugas seorang Web Master

Pengertian Web Master

Web Master adalah sebuah pekerjaan yang mengharuskan sesorang untuk mengerti akan semua hal mulai dari desain dari sebuah website, program dari sebuah web dan keamanan server akan tetapi tidak terlalu mencampuri masing-masing divisi dari sebuah website, yaitu cukup dengan mempertanggung jawabkan atas jalannya sebuah website. menjadi seorang web master juga harus mengetahui informasi dari semua website sehingga jika terjadi masalah dalam website tersebut dapat segera ditangani.

Baca Juga: Pengertian dan Tugas Web Administrator


Tugas Seorang Web Master

Pada dasarnya seorang web master bertugas untuk menjaga jalannya sebuah website. Lancar da tidaknys sebuah website akan menjadi tanggung jawab penuh oleh seorang web master. Web master akan segera memperbaiki coding dari sebuah website apabila ada link dari website yang mengalami kerusakan. Selain itu seorang web master juga harus menjaga keamanan / security dari sebuah website tersebut.

Baca Juga: Pengertian dan Tugas Sebagai Web Programmer

Untuk menjadi seorang web master profesional sesorang harus menguasahi ilmu dasar tentang komputer dan pemrograman diantaranya:

  • HTML, DHTML
  • CGI Perl, PHP, MySQL, ASP, Java
  • Penguasaan terhadap macam - macam Sistem Operasi Komputer baik server maupun client
  • Kemanan Server
  • Jaringan Komputer (LAN, WAN dan Internet)

Sabtu, 13 Agustus 2016

Pengertian dan Tugas Web Administrator

Pengertian Web Administrator

Web Administrator adalah sebuah pekerjaan yang memfokuskan diri untuk memperbaiki sebuah server baik itu instalasi sampai dengan masalah trobleshooting pada komputer server. Web Administrator akan menjaga kelangsungan dan kelancaran dari server untuk tetap bisa berjalan sehingga jika terjadi problem/masalah pada server, web administrator harus siap untuk memperbaikinya.

Baca Juga: Pengertian dan Tugas Sebagai Web Programmer

Tugas Web Administrator

Seorang Web Administrator bertugas untuk memaintenance atau memperbaiki suatu server, mengerti akan sistem operasi server baik instalasi sampai trobleshooting (masalah). Untuk itu seorang web administrator harus benar - benar siap kapan saja.


Baca Juga: Pengertian Web Designer dan Syarat Untuk Menjadi Web Designer Profesional

Keahlian yang harus dikuasai sebagai Web Administrator

Untuk memaksimalkan pekerjaannya seorang web administrator harus menguasahi beberapa hal, diantaranya:

  • OS Unix (LInux, FreeBSD, dll) - Seorang web administrator harus menguasahi macam-macam sistem operasi basis linux, baik itu instalasi maupun trobleshootingnya.
  • OS NT - Seorang web administrator harus menguasahi macam-macam sistem operasi basis windows, baik itu instalasi maupun trobleshootingnya.
  • Jaringan (LAN, WAN, Intranet) - Seorang web administrator harus mempunyai bekal pengetahuan bidang jaringan komputer
  • Keamanan Server - Seorang web administrator harus paham tentang sistem sekurity dan keamanan pada server

Pengertian dan Tugas Sebagai Web Programmer

Pengertian Web Programmer

Web programmer adalah sebuah pekerjaan dalam bidang teknologi informasi yang mana didalam pekerjaan tersebut seorang web programmer akan melakukan pengcodingan dan pemrograman sebuah website. Web Programmer akan membuat script atau coding untuk membuat halaman web akan terlihat lebih dinamis dan menarik. Sebuah website yang biasa akan terlihat sangat membosankan dengan tampilan yang standart untuk itu web programmer akan membuat coding agar website yang diciptakan terlihat lebih dinamis.


Tugas Seorang Web Programmer

Web Programmer adalah orang yang bertugas melakukan pengcodingan dan pemrograman sebuah website agar terlihan lebih dinamis dan agar web tersebut dapat terlihat mudah bagi seorang web admin. Jika situs yang akan dibuat mempunya fasilitas interaksi antara pengunjung dan situs misalnya menyangkut dengan transaksi, input output data dan database maka seorang Web Programmer yang akan mengerjakannya dengan membuat aplikasi-aplikasi yang berkerja diatas situs (web).

Baca Juga: Pengertian Web Designer dan Syarat Untuk Menjadi Web Designer

Ilmu yang harus dikuasai orang seorang web programmer

Untuk menjadi seorang web programmer profesional seorang web programmer harus menguasahi dasar-dasar ilmu komputer dan pemrograman yaitu:

  • CGI Perl, PHP, MySQL (Unix base)
  • ASP (NT base)
  • Java Script dan Applet

Senin, 11 April 2016

Pengertian dan Fungsi HTML (HyperText Markup Language)

Pengertian HTML (HyperText Markup Language)

HTML atau HyperText Markup Language adalah sebuah bahasa pemrograman yang digunakan untuk membuat sebuah website sehingga dari halaman website tersebut dapat menampilkan informasi yang berguna bagi para pengguna internet.

HTML sendiri terdiri dari komponen beberapa script yang terbentuk menjadi sebuh tag penyusun dokumen html. Untuk dapat belajar HTML memang gampang-gampang susah karena jika terjadi salah pengetikan sedikit saja maka akan mengalami eror pada dokumen tersebut.

HTML tersusun dari kumpulan text yang disertai dengan link sehingga memudahkan pengguna dalam mengakses sebuah informasi. Dengan HTML kita bisa mengatur model tulisan, header pada web, body bahkan isi dari sebuah website.

Baca Juga: Pengertian dan Fungsi Domain


Fungsi HTML (Hypertext markup Language)

HTML berfungsi untuk mengelola, menghubungkan, menampilkan serangkaian informasi dan data sehingga dokumen-dokumen tersebut mudah untuk diakses melalui jaringan internet. Selain itu fungsi utama dari HTML itu sendiri adalah sebagai berikut:
  • Berfungsi untuk membuat halaman sebuah website
  • Berfungsi untuk menampilkan informasi dari database ke dalam sebuah browser
  • Berfungsi untuk menghubungkan link ke halaman lain di dalam sebuah website dengan menggunakan kode tertentu (hypertext)

Sabtu, 24 Oktober 2015

Pengertian Microsoft SQL Server beserta kelebihan dan kelemahannya

Pengertian Microsoft SQL Server
Microsoft SQL Server merupakan sistem manajemen basis data relasional yang dirancang untuk aplikasi dengan arsitektur client server. Fitur pada Microsoft SQl Server yaitu mempunyai kemampuan untuk membuat basis data mirroring dan clustering. Microsoft SQL Server juga mendukung SQL sebagai bahasa untuk memproses query ke dalam database dan kita tahu bahwa SQL ini sudah digunakan secara umum pada semua produk database server.

Kelebihan Microsoft SQL Server
  • Dengan kemampuannya untuk mengolah data yang besar maka DBMS ini sangat cocok untuk perusahaan mikro, menengah hingga perusahaan besar sekalipun.
  • DBMS jenis memiliki kelebihan memanage user data serta masing-masing user dapat diatur hak aksesnya terhadap pengaksesan data base oleh DBA
  • Mempunyai tingkat keamanan data yang sangat baik
  • Dapat melakukan back up, recovery dan rollback data dengan mudah
  • Mempunyai kelebihan untuk membuat data base mirroring dan clustering
Kekurangan Microsoft SQL Server
  • DBMS jenisini hanya dapat berjalan pada sistem operasi / platform windows saja.
  • Software ini mempunyai lisensi dari microsoft sehingga pemakaiannya membutuhkan biaya yang cukup mahal.

Pengertian Oracle beserta kelebihan dan kelemahannya

Pengertian Oracle
Oracle merupakan Relational Database Management System yang berfungsi untuk mengelola informasi secara terbuka, komprehensif dan terintegrasi. Oracle server memungkinkan untuk menyediakan solusi yang efekstif dan efisien karena kemampuannya dalam pengelolaan database.

Oracle dikembangkan tahun 1977 oleh Larry Ellison, Bob Miner dan Ed Oates melalui perusahaan konsultasinya bernama Software Development Laboratories (SDL). Pada tahun 1983, perusahaan ini berubah nama menjadi Oracle Corporation sampai sekarang.


Kelebihan Oracle
  • Terdapat beragam fitur yang bisa memenuhi tuntutan fleksibelitas dari perusahaan yang besar
  • Bisa menggunakan dan mendayagunakan lebih dari satu server
  • Penyimpanan data dapat dilakukan dengan cukup mudah
  • Performa pemrosesan transaksi yang sangt tinggi
  • Bisa berjalan pada lebih dari satu platform system operasi.
Kekurangan Oracle
  • Membutuhkan biaya yang cukup mahal karena membutuhkan DBA yang cukup handal dan DBMS jenis ini cukup rumit
  • Membutuhkan spesifikasi hardware yang tinggi
  • jika data bertambah maka akan mengalami kelambatan proses (lemot)

Pengertian MySQL beserta kelebihan dan kelemahannya

Pengertian MySQL
MySQL merupakan sebuah perangkat lunak atau software sistem manajemen basis data SQL atau  DBMS Multithread dan multi user. MySQl sebenarnya merupakan turunan dari salah satu konsep utama dalam database untuk pemilihan atau seleksi dan pemasukan data yang memungkinkan pengoperasian data dikerjakan secara mudah dan otomatis. MySQL diciptakan oleh Michael "Monty" Widenius pada tahun 1979, seorang programmer komputer asal Swedia yang mengembangkan sebuah sistem database sederhana yang dinamakan UNIREG yang menggunakan koneksi low-level ISAM database engine dengan indexing.


Kelebihan MySQL
Adapun kelebihan MySQl dalam penggunaanya dalam database adalah:
  • Free atau gratis sehingga MySQL dapat dengan mudah untuk mendapatkannya.
  • MySQl stabil dan tangguh dalam pengoperasiannya
  • My SQl mempunyai sistem keamanan yang cukup baik
  • Sangat mendukung transaksi dan mempunyai banyak dukungan dari komunitas
  • Sangat fleksibel dengan berbagai macam program
  • Perkembangan dari MySQl sangat cepat
Kelemahan MySQL
Selain kelebihan yang disampaikan diatas, ada beberapa kekurangan yang dimiliki oleh mySQl, diantaranya:
  • Kurang mendukung koneksi bahasa pemrograman seperti Visual basic atau biasa kita kenal dengan sebutan VB, Foxpro, Delphi dan lain-lain sebab koneksi ini menyebabkan field yang dibaca harus sesuai dengan koneksi dari bahasa pemrograman visual tersebut.
  • Data yang dapat ditangani belum besar dan belum mendukung widowing function.

Rabu, 14 Oktober 2015

Perbedaan DDL (Data Definition Language) dan DML (Data Manipulation Language)

DDL (Data Definition Language) dan DML (Data Manipulation Language) adalah bagian dari DBMS (Database Management System) yang berisi perintah-perintah untuk membuat, merubah maupun memodifikasi dan menghapus data pada database. (Baca juga: Pengertian dan Fungsi DBMS (Database Management System)

Apa yang dimaksud DDL (Data Definition Language)?
DDL (Data Definition Language) merupakan kumpulan perintah SQL yang dipakai dalam pembuatan, perubahan dan penghapusan data pada database seperti: tabel, indeks, trigger, fungsi dan lain-lain. (Baca juga: Pengertian dan Fungsi DDL (Data Definition Language)

Berikut adalah perintah SQL yang termasuk DDL (Data Definition Language)
  • Create berfungsi untuk membuat database baru
  • Alter berfungsi untuk merubah database
  • Drop berfungsi untuk menghapus database
Apa yang dimaksud DML (Data Manipulation Language)?
DML (Data Manipulation Language) merupakan kumpulan perintah yang berfungsi untuk memanipulasi data pada tabel dalam database. DML (Data Manipulation Language) berisi kumpulan perintah seperti: menambah(Insert), merubah(update) dan menghapus(delete) data pada tabel. (Baca juga: Pengertian dan Fungsi DML (Data Manipulation Language)

Berikut adalah perintah yang termasuk DML (Data Manipulation Language)
  • Insert berfungsi untuk menambah data pada tabel
  • Update berfungsi untuk merubah data pada tabel
  • Delete berfungsi untuk menghapus data dari suatu tabel

Pengertian dan Fungsi DML (Data Manipulation Language) beserta perintahnya

Pengertian DML (Data Manipulation Language) pada database
DML atau singkatan dari Data Manipulation Language merupakan kumpulan perintah query yang digunakan untuk memanipulasi data pada database. Misalnya digunakan untuk menambah data, merubah data, maupun menghapus data pada database

Fungsi dari DML (Data Manipulation Language) pada database
DML (Data Manipulation Language) berfungsi untuk memanipulasi database seperti: menambah data, merubah/mengganti data dan menghapus data. Perintah pda DML tidak terkait dengan struktur dan metadata dari obyek yang berada pada tabel database

Perintah - perintah pada DML (Data Manipulation Language)
Berikut adalah perintah-perintah yang paling sering digunakan pada DML (Data Manipulation Language):
  • Insert berfungsi untuk menambah data atau record pada database
  • Delete berfungsi untuk menghapus data pada database
  • Update yaitu perintah yang berfungsi untuk merubah maupun memperbarui data pada database
  • Select yaitu perintah yang digunakan untuk menampilkan data dari suatu tabel pada database.

Pengertian dan Fungsi DDL (Data Definition Language) serta Perintah DDL

Pengertian DDL (Data Definition Language)
DDL adalah singkatan dari Data Definition Language yaitu kumpulan perintah pada SQL untuk menggambarkan desain dari database secara menyeluruh, selain itu DDL (Data Definition Language) juga digunakan untuk membuat, merubah maupun menghapus struktur atau definisi tipe data dari obyek yang ada pada database.

Fungsi DDL (Data Definition Language)
DDL (Data Definition Language) berfungsi untuk membuat, merubah dan menghapus struktur data pada database.

Berikut adalah perintah-perintah pada DDL (Data Definition Language)
1. Perintah Create / Membuat
  • Create database berfungsi untuk membuat database baru
  • Create Function berfungsi untuk membuat fungsi pada database
  • Create index berfungsi untuk membuat index pada database
  • Create procedur berfungsi untuk membuat procedure pada data dase
  • Create Table yaitu perintah yang digunakan untuk membuat tabel baru pada database
  • Create Trigger berfungsi untuk membuat trigger pada database
2. Perintah untuk merubah
  • Alter Table yaitu perintah yang digunakan untuk merubah struktur dari sebuah tabel
3. Perintah untuk menghapus / Drop
  • Drop Database yaitu perintah yang berfungsi untuk menghapus database (Contoh: DROP nama_databases;)
  • Drop Table yaitu perintah yang digunakan untuk menghapus tabel pada database

Pengertian dan Fungsi DBMS (Database Management System)

Pengertian DBMS (Database Management System)
DBMS (Database Management System) merupakan sistem pengorganisasian data pada komputer. DBMS (Database Management System) adalah perangkat lunak yang memungkinkan untuk membangun basis data yang berbasis komputerisasi. DBMS (Database Management System) adalah perantara user dengan basis data sehingga dengan adanya DBMS (Database Management System), user akan dengan mudah mencari dan menambahkan informasi pada data base.

Untuk dapat mengakses DBMS (Database Management System) user harus menggunakan bahasa database, bahasa database terdiri dari beberapa intruksi yang digabungkan sehungga dapat diproses oleh DBMS. Perintah atau intruksi tersebut umumnya ditentukan oleh user, adapaun bahasa yang digunakan dibagi kedalam 2 (dua) macam diantaranya sebagaimana di bawah ini:

1. DDL (Data Definition Language)

DDL atau singkatan dari Data Definition Languange, yaitu dipakai untuk menggambarkan desain dari basis data secara menyeluruh. DDL (Data Definition Language) dapat dipakai untuk membuat tabel baru, memuat indeks, maupun mengubah tabel. Hasil dari kompilasi DDL akan disimpan di kamus data. Itulah definisi dari DDL.

2. DML (Data Manipulation Language)

DML atau singkatan dari Data Manipulation Language, yaitu dipakai untuk memanipulasi daan pengambilan data pada suatu basis data, misalnya seperti penambahan data yang baru ke dalam suatu basis data, menghapus data pada seuatu basis data dan mengubah data pada suatu basis data. Itulah definisi dar DML.

Fungsi dari DBMS (Database Management System)
Fungsi dari DBMS adalah sebagai penghubung antara user dengan database sehingga memungkinkan pengguna dapat mengakses database dengan cepat dan mudah. Adapun contoh-contoh dari DBMS (Database Management System) adalah : MySQL, Oracle dan microsoft SQL Server

Komponen-komponen dari DBMS (Database Management System)

  • File manager berfungsi untuk mengelola struktur data yang digunakan untuk mempresentasikan informasi yang tersimpan dalam disk.
  • Database Manager berfungsi untuk menyediakan interface antar data dengan program alikasi dan query
  • Query Processor berfungsi sebagai penterjemah perintah dalam bahasa query ke intruksi low รข€“ level yang dapat dimengerti database manager.
  • DML Precompiler berfungsi sebagai pengkonversi pernyataan atau perintah DML, yang ditambahkan dalam suatu program aplikasi kepemangin prosedur normal dalam bahasa induk.
  • DDL Compiler digunakan untuk mengkonversi berbagai perintah DDL ke dalam sekumpulan tabel yang mengandung metadata.